A Comprehensive Guide to Amino Acid L-Isoleucine
Amino acids are the building blocks of proteins and play a crucial role in various biochemical processes within the body. Among the essential amino acids, L-Isoleucine stands out as a key player in energy production, muscle metabolism, and immune system support. This unique amino acid not only contributes to the maintenance of muscle tissue but also acts as a critical component in various metabolic functions. In this guide, we will explore the types, functions and features, applications, and advantages of amino acid L-Isoleucine.
Types of Amino Acid L-Isoleucine
L-Isoleucine can be found in various forms, primarily categorized based on their sources and specific formulations:
- Natural Sources: L-Isoleucine is abundantly found in protein-rich foods such as meat, fish, eggs, dairy products, and legumes.
- Supplement Form: This amino acid is also available as a dietary supplement, often combined with other bran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s) to enhance athletic performance and recovery.
- Powder vs. Capsule: L-Isoleucine supplements are offered in both powder and capsule forms, providing flexibility in how individuals choose to consume them.
- Vegan Options: Vegan-friendly L-Isoleucine supplements are derived from plant-based sources, catering to those following a plant-based lifestyle.
Functions and Features of Amino Acid L-Isoleucine
L-Isoleucine serves multiple functions crucial for overall health, particularly in the context of athletic performance and recovery. Its distinctive features include:
- Energy Production: L-Isoleucine is a vital source of energy, especially during prolonged physical activity, making it essential for athletes and active individuals.
- Muscle Maintenance: This amino acid aids in preserving muscle mass by promoting protein synthesis, which is key during weight loss or rigorous training programs.
- Immune Support: L-Isoleucine plays a role in bolstering the immune system, enhancing the body’s ability to fend off illnesses and infections.
- Regulatory Functions: It helps in regulating blood sugar levels and stabilizing energy levels, assisting the body in maintaining optimal performance throughout the day.
Applications and Advantages of Amino Acid L-Isoleucine
The applications of L-Isoleucine extend across various domains, especially in sports nutrition and wellness. The advantages include:
- Enhanced Athletic Performance: L-Isoleucine supplements can boost endurance and muscle recovery, making them popular among athletes looking for a competitive edge.
- Weight Management: By supporting muscle preservation during fat loss, L-Isoleucine contributes to effective weight management strategies.
- Supports Healing: The amino acid plays a role in wound healing and recovery post-exercise, facilitating a quicker return to training.
- Promotes Muscle Recovery: Its ability to reduce muscle soreness and fatigue makes L-Isoleucine an integral part of post-workout supplementation.
